In the given figure, \(BD = 6\) and \(DC =4.\) If angle \(BAD = 30^{\circ}\) and angle \(ADC = 120^{\circ},\) find the area of the triangle \(ADC.\)

a. \(6\sqrt3\, \text{cm}^2\)
b. \(8\sqrt3\, \text{cm}^2\)
c. \(10\sqrt3\, \text{cm}^2\)
d. \(12\sqrt3 \, \text{cm}^2\)
e. \(18\sqrt3 \, \text{cm}^2\)

Answer: D
